## Build Provenance: ImageCache Leak Fix

Plugin authors targeting the Quillbrook SDK should note that versions prior to 4.2 leaked decoded bitmaps in the shared image cache under rapid scroll. Verify your host app includes the patched cache module before relying on eviction callbacks. The first verified build carrying the fix is identified by the token below.

pipeline stamp: htk9_6ce9d33c5

Capacity-planning note for the SproutTick watering scheduler, prepared for security review. The scheduler polls up to 4,000 moisture sensors per site and enqueues valve commands; queue depth grows linearly with sensor count but quadratically under retry storms, which is the main abuse vector we considered. Rate limits are enforced at the gateway before any valve actuation, and all retry backoffs are bounded. The enforcement layer reads its bounds from a single constants block, reproduced here for your inspection.

tuning table, kajef-kaweg:
PRIORITIES = {
    "druwyn": 920,
    "norys": 556,
    "jordor": 792,
}

Handover — flaky DNS on the Oxbill ingest cluster. New folks, read this first. Symptom: intermittent resolution failures for internal service names, roughly every 40–60 minutes, only on nodes in the Tarnmoor zone. Suspected cause: stale resolver cache fighting the zone-local forwarder. Mitigation in place: cron flushes the cache hourly — ugly, works. Don't remove it until the forwarder fix ships. Logs are in the usual ingest bucket. Resolver admin console unlocks with the passphrase below.

strongbox words: ulaael-wenix

Subject: Handover — Quillbase ORM refactor release

Hi Soren,

Handing over the Quillbase legacy ORM refactor release. The query-builder shim is gone; all models now use the new mapper. Migration scripts are idempotent and ran clean in staging. For your security review, note that release artifacts are signed before publication and verified at deploy time. The signing key currently in use is included below.

rollout seal: bky9_PeXH1fTLY